Abstract

See full text

A kit containing a splitter and drill guide for installing the splitter behind a circular saw blade to prevent contact between the cut work piece and the upwardly moving rear portion of the saw blade. The splitter includes a plurality of pegs that are installed into splitter location holes drilled into the saw work surface or a zero clearance insert. The holes are positioned using the drill guide that is indexed from the side of an actual kerf rather than from a side of the saw blade. In this manner, variations in kerf width resulting from variations in blade width and vibration of the saw blade are accommodated. Splitters having incremental amounts of offset between the centerline of the pegs and the planar surface of the splitter may be selected to provide a desired degree of interference and resulting force between the splitter and the work piece.
